Grade 6 Pieces

One piece must be chosen from each of Lists A, B and C.
Please note that the first three pieces in each list are found in the ABRSM Flute Grade 6 2022 Pieces Book:

ABRSM Flute Grade 6 2022 Pieces Grade 6 (pieces, piano parts and audio download)

List A

1 J. S. Bach Bourrée anglaise (4th movt from Partita in A minor, BWV 1013)
2 Godard Allegretto (No. 1 from Suite de trois morceaux, Op. 116)
3 Telemann Cantabile and Allegro (1st and 2nd movts from Sonata in C, TWV 41:C2)
4 J. S. Bach Polonaise and Double (5th movt from Suite in B minor, BWV 1067), J. S. Bach: Suite No. 2 in B minor, BWV 1067 (Peters) or Overture (Orchestral Suite) in B minor, BWV 1067 (Bärenreiter)
5 A. Bon Allegro, 3rd movt, from Sonata No. 2, Op. 1, Vol. 1 (Furore Verlag)
6 Cavallini Theme and Variation, No. 59 from More Graded Studies for Flute, Book 2 (Faber) [Solo]
7 Drouet Allegro moderato (1st movt from Sonata No. 2 in A minor), Drouet: Three Little Sonatas (Schott)
8 attrib. Gossec Tambourin, Flute Favourites, Vol. 1 (Fentone) or The Chester Flute Anthology (Chester)
9 Handel Allegro (2nd movt from Sonata in C, HWV 365, Op. 1 No. 7), Handel: 11 Sonatas for Flute (Bärenreiter)
10 Vivaldi Allegro (1st movt from Concerto in D, RV 783) flute to play in tuttis, Vivaldi: Concerto in D, RV 783 (Bärenreiter)

LIST B

1 Baker Nocturne (No. 6 from Six Poèmes Noir) tremolo and flutter-tonguing optional
2 Mel Bonis Une flûte soupire
3 Jacob On a Summer Evening
4 Gaubert Sicilienne Gaubert: Sicilienne (Heugel)
5 Geraldine Green Nocturne Vocalise (Astute Music)
6 Harbach & Kern Smoke Gets in Your Eyes (from Roberta), arr. Iveson, Let’s Face the Music for Flute (Brass Wind) With CD
7 John McLeod Berceuse (No. 2 from Le Tombeau de Poulenc), John McLeod: Le Tombeau de Poulenc (Griffin Music)
8 Rabboni (& Vignoles) Sonata No. 8 in C, Rabboni: Sonatas for Flute and Piano, Book 1 (Kevin Mayhew)
9 John Rutter Prelude (1st movt from Suite antique), John Rutter: Suite Antique (OUP)
10 Andy Scott And Everything is Still… for Flute (Astute Music)

LIST C

1 Büsser Les écureuils (No. 2 from Deux morceaux)
2 Billy Mayerl Bats in the Belfry, arr. Adams
3 Kwabena Nketia Movement 1 (from Republic Suite)
4 Alan Bullard Comical Flute, No. 35 from Fifty for Flute, Book 2 (ABRSM) [Solo]
5 Dring Polka, Dring: Polka (Arcadia)
6 Paul Harris With a Hint of Lime, Music Through Time, Flute Book 4 (OUP)
7 Bryan Kelly Prélude français with repeat, New Pieces for Flute, Book 2 (ABRSM)
8 Oliver Ledbury Imaginings, from Flute Salad (Brass Wind) [Solo]
9 Jim Parker Whistling Blues, Jazzed Up Too for Flute (Brass Wind)
10 Russell Stokes Con brio, No. 6 from Jazz Singles (Hunt Edition) [Solo]

Photocopies & downloads
Candidates should not perform from unauthorised photocopies (or other kinds of copies) or illegal downloads of copyright music in examinations. There are limited circumstances where can copies be used in an examination the UK. The MPA’s Code of Fair Practice gives further guidance. Before making a copy an application should be made to the copyright holder and evidence of permission should be brought to the exam. Candidates and Applicants must act within the law with regard to copyright.
